Job Description

We are seeking a candidate with hands-on Axway SecureTransport (ST) engineering experience with designing, building, and supporting Advanced Routing (AR) for managed file transfers (MFT). The ideal candidate is proficient with an Axway ST 5.5-2026x platform running on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L), ST MFT automation, enterprise security practices, and can operate in a highly regulated, mission-critical environment.

Total years of relevant Experience

- 5+ years administering Axway SecureTransport in production

- 5+ years Linux/RHEL system administration

- 3+ years designing/supporting Advanced Routing (policies, routes, partners, transfer sites, subscriptions, schedules)

- 3+ years Tier3 operational troubleshooting across ST protocols and routing decisions

- 3+ years enterprise security (SSH/PKI/PGP, TLS, certificates)

Preferred Education

Bachelor s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or equivalent technical study; relevant certifications (Linux/Security/Axway) a plus.

Knowledge

  • Axway SecureTransport architecture, deployment, and administration on RHEL
  • SecureTransport Advanced Routing concepts: route design, policy configuration, subscriptions, partner setup, rule evaluation, and SLA enforcement
  • Secure transport protocols: SFTP/SSH, HTTPS/TLS, FTPS and message security (PGP/GPG)
  • Enterprise networking fundamentals relevant to ST operations (load balancers, firewalls, NAT, DNS, IP subnets, routing)
  • Identity & access management and rolebased access control for ST users and partners
  • Observability and monitoring tools (e.g., Splunk, Dynatrace) and log analysis techniques for MFT platforms
  • Certificate lifecycle management (CSRs, issuance, renewal, pinning) and trust store/key store administration
  • Security hardening aligned to enterprise/CIS/NIST guidance and audit requirements
